Abstract

FEATURES Earth is fortunate to be orbiting a star that is fairly constant in its light production. Images such as this have revealed numerous RR Lyrae stars in our galaxy's bulge, hinting that it is old and may have been built up as primordial star clusters merged together over time. RR Lyrae variables are standard candles - objects for which their intrinsic brightness is known, so that a comparison with their observed apparent brightness allows astronomers to calculate their distance. With the high-resolution imaging capabilities of the Hubble Space Telescope (HST), it is routinely possible to identify and characterize RR Lyrae stars in galaxies well beyond the Milky Way.
